Understanding Football OTAs: Schedule, Purpose, and Importance

Football teams ' Organized Training Activities, or OTAs, are a crucial part of the springtime preparation routine. Typically spanning over three segments in May and June, OTAs allow players the occasion to work on plays, enhance chemistry, and acclimate to the new offensive and defensive systems . While restricted contact is allowed , OTAs are largely focused on exercises and teaching the game plan . They’re much less intense than training the training period but are incredibly important for determining player preparedness and ensuring the club is well-prepared for the upcoming season. Essentially, OTAs are a building block toward peak performance.
